| Package | Description |
|---|---|
| icu.easyj.spring.boot.test | |
| icu.easyj.spring.boot.test.result |
| Modifier and Type | Method and Description |
|---|---|
MockResponse |
MockResponse.isOk()
请求成功,响应200
|
MockResponse |
MockRequest.send()
发送模拟请求
|
| Modifier and Type | Field and Description |
|---|---|
protected MockResponse |
BaseResult.mockResponse |
| Modifier and Type | Method and Description |
|---|---|
MockResponse |
BaseResult.end()
结束对当前响应结果的校验,可继续对下一个响应结果的校验,也可直接结束不校验了。
部分类型的响应结果,为一次性校验,无需主动调用此方法。
|
MockResponse |
CharacterEncodingResult.is(Charset expectedCharset) |
MockResponse |
GenericContentResult.is(Consumer<T> expectedValidateFun)
可自定义验证方法
|
MockResponse |
StatusResult.is(org.springframework.http.HttpStatus... expectedStatusArr) |
MockResponse |
StatusResult.is(org.springframework.http.HttpStatus expectedStatus) |
MockResponse |
StatusResult.is(int... expectedStatusValueArr) |
MockResponse |
StatusResult.is(int expectedStatusValue) |
MockResponse |
ContentTypeResult.is(org.springframework.http.MediaType expectedMediaType) |
MockResponse |
CharacterEncodingResult.is(String expectedCharacterEncoding) |
MockResponse |
ContentTypeResult.is(String expectedContentType) |
MockResponse |
ContentTypeResult.is(String expectedMediaType,
String expectedMediaSubtype) |
MockResponse |
StatusResult.isClientErrorSeries()
判断响应状态为 4xx 系列
|
MockResponse |
StatusResult.isInformationalSeries()
判断响应状态为 1xx 系列
|
MockResponse |
StatusResult.isOk() |
MockResponse |
StatusResult.isRedirectionSeries()
判断响应状态为 3xx 系列
|
MockResponse |
StatusResult.isSeries(org.springframework.http.HttpStatus.Series... expectedStatusSeriesArr)
判断响应状态系列
|
MockResponse |
StatusResult.isSeries(org.springframework.http.HttpStatus.Series expectedStatusSeries)
判断响应状态系列
|
MockResponse |
StatusResult.isServerErrorSeries()
判断响应状态为 5xx 系列
|
MockResponse |
StatusResult.isSuccessfulSeries()
判断响应状态为 2xx 系列
|
| Constructor and Description |
|---|
BaseResult(MockResponse mockResponse)
构造函数
|
CharacterEncodingResult(MockResponse mockResponse,
String characterEncoding) |
ContentResult(MockResponse mockResponse,
org.springframework.test.web.servlet.ResultActions resultActions,
String content) |
ContentTypeResult(MockResponse mockResponse,
String contentType) |
FileExportResult(MockResponse mockResponse,
org.springframework.test.web.servlet.ResultActions resultActions,
byte[] fileBytes)
构造函数
|
GenericContentResult(MockResponse mockResponse,
org.springframework.test.web.servlet.ResultActions resultActions,
T content)
构造函数
|
HeaderResult(MockResponse mockResponse,
org.springframework.mock.web.MockHttpServletResponse response) |
ListContentResult(MockResponse mockResponse,
org.springframework.test.web.servlet.ResultActions resultActions,
List<T> list)
构造函数
|
StatusResult(MockResponse mockResponse,
int status) |
Copyright © 2021–2022 EasyJ????. All rights reserved.